Roll (gymnastics) - Wikipedia

A roll is the most basic and fundamental skill in gymnastics class. There are many variations in the skill. Rolls are similar to flips in the fact that they are a complete rotation of the body, but the rotation of the roll is usually made on the ground while a flip is made in the air with the hips passing over the head and without any hands touching the ground.

Roll, Pitch, and Yaw | How Things Fly

The Ailerons Control Roll On the outer rear edge of each wing, the two ailerons move in opposite directions, up and down, decreasing lift on one wing while increasing it on the other. This causes the airplane to roll to the left or right. To turn the airplane, the pilot uses the ailerons to tilt the wings in the desired direction.

Roll Forward Definition

Roll forward is the closing of a shorter-term derivative contract and opening of a new longer-term contract for the same underlying asset.

Role or Roll? - Grammar Monster

Role and roll are easy to confuse. Role is an 'actor's portrayal of a character' or 'a job or function.' Roll is a 'list (usually of names)' or a 'piece of bread.' The verb 'to roll' usually means 'to move by rotating.' This page has example sentences to explain the difference and an interactive exercise.
